Board games!

Come along to Preston's Gamer's Guild, we meet every Tuesday from 6:30pm at Plunginton community centre. We have about 40-50 people a week, you can just turn up or sign up in advance (we use an app called Gogo game arranger and have a facebook chat group).

No experience required, we provide the games, the snacks and hot drinks.

This week is also bake off (people are encouraged to bake, but no obligation) prizes for 1st, 2nd and 3rd place. So two hobbies in one plus we're all mostly awesome :)

Preston Board Gamers! Friendly welcoming group who meet on Monday evening at the Empire Services Club. 7-11. No need to bring games, just come along.
We also go hiking, away on trips, meet for food and drinks and people do fitness etc together. It’s a great group.

Walton has a bouldering gym, and Preston Wall at West View Better Health has a bouldering room. Climbers are usually friendly so start being a regular there! I’m a solo climber who has no belay buddy and I’ve become reasonably well known to the staff and other climbers by being there frequently and striking up a conversation with random people.

There are two local casual football teams that are constantly looking for new players. Bamber Bridge MHFC and Preston Casuals. They play 5/6 a side and sometimes 11's.

I know there is board game group that operate in Preston which I hear is very inclusive and I have been tempted myself in the past.

Chews Yard do a lot of clubs. So, give them a follow on socials or message them and I'm sure they will tell you what they do.

There is the American football team the Lancashire Buccaneers. But, their season is nearly over. But, will be opening try outs for people in December. This for experienced and people that have never played before.

To be honest, there is a lot of things to do in Preston.

Search red rose darts hub on Facebook. They have competitions every week for all levels from beginner to advanced and is a great way to make new friends. The manager, Nathan, is really friendly too and is always willing to help show the basics or how to sign up for a comp
